A Tattoo to Remember
My daughter just had a World War II formal portrait of her grandfather; my father tattooed onto her arm. It’s always been a favorite photo of ours and this was her way of honoring our hero while he walks by her side as her escort for eternity. The Holiday season is always a season to remember and between the Holidays, and the new tattoo, I have been remembering a lot lately and thought I would write a few things down. Endurance Sports Expo Returning February 26-27
The Endurance Sports Expo is returning in 2011 with a new date and a larger space at the Greater Philadelphia Expo Center in Oaks, PA. The second year expo will be held February 26-27, just in time for starting your season off right. The Endurance Sports Expo is moving to a space that is 2.5 times the size of last year.
